<p>We’re renting a house with an old Jenn-Air electric oven/cooktop. We’re used to gas so are not sure what the different dials/burners do. Two of the dials are just straight low to high, but the other two have two ranges from lo-hi. There’s a single circle symbol for the odd numbered range, and a double circle symbol for the even numbered range. <p>Here ya go. Some Jennair ranges had two element burners, allowing you to heat the entire burner (for a big pot) or just the smaller inner burner:</p>

<p>Push in and turn to the left to operate both elements (the dual circle indicator). Push in and turn to the right to operate just the inner element (the single circle marking).</p>
